PHARMACEUTICAL COMPANY SET TO LAUNCH IN OGUN

A pharmaceutical company that specialises in the production of medication kits for the treatment of diabetes, hypertension, and heart-related diseases is set for commissioning in Ogun State, signaling another major boost in Ogun State investment opportunities.

Chief Executive Officer of Codix Bio Pharmaceutical Company, Mr. Sammy Ogunjimi, disclosed this during a courtesy visit to Governor Dapo Abiodun at his office in Oke-Mosan, Abeokuta, stating that the factory, located along the Sagamu-Ijebu-Ode Expressway, is poised to make significant impact across Nigeria and Africa.

Mr. Ogunjimi revealed that the company is partnering with the World Health Organization (WHO) on technology transfer to build capacity for manufacturing Rapid Diagnostics Tests, starting with HIV, malaria, and others. According to him, the company—which began operations in 2008—focuses on cardio-metabolic health challenges, especially diabetes and heart diseases.

“When we came to Nigeria, we realized that the biggest issue is effective diagnosis. People are often misdiagnosed due to lack of proper tools or knowledge. In 2009, we were the first to facilitate the national guidelines for diagnosing diabetes in Nigeria,” he said.

He explained that although 99 percent of diagnostic kits are used in Africa, none are manufactured on the continent. With the new facility, that narrative is set to change. “This project, which will be commissioned on Friday, is the only one of its kind. We’re receiving technology transfer from SG Biosensor, and our goal is to not only serve Nigeria but all of Africa,” he added.

The CEO further announced plans to establish another factory within 18 months, focused on contract manufacturing for generic products in Nigeria. He noted that his decision to invest in Ogun was largely influenced by the ease of doing business in Ogun, the welcoming investment climate, and his roots in Sagamu.

“For me, as a son of the soil, I’ve used my network to ensure that this industry finds its home here. Ogun State has shown strong leadership in creating an enabling environment for business,” he said.
Responding, Governor Dapo Abiodun emphasized the importance of aligning education and healthcare with the needs of emerging investors and industries. He described Ogun as the “education capital of Nigeria,” stressing the government’s role in repositioning institutions like the Olabisi Onabanjo University Teaching Hospital and upgrading the School of Nursing into a degree-awarding college.

He affirmed the government’s readiness to support projects like Codix Bio’s, which align with the broader goals of Ogun economic development and improved public health systems. “We’ve renovated more than 100 Primary Healthcare Centres and plan to reach 236, ensuring one per ward under our hub-and-spoke healthcare model,” he noted.

Governor Abiodun reiterated his administration’s commitment to strengthening infrastructure and public services in line with its ISEYA pillars. “We’re glad to support projects that tick all the right boxes—healthcare, innovation, jobs, and manufacturing. This is a strategic contribution to Ogun State infrastructure development and long-term industrialisation,” he said.

He concluded by noting that the RDT manufacturing plant will be the first of its scale in Nigeria and the second largest in sub-Saharan Africa, reiterating the State’s promise to collaborate with genuine investors and provide essential infrastructure for residents and businesses to thrive.
